And type of trimmer will be limited by how close it will get. But technically, by definition, a trimmer is not a shaver. It will result in a tight buzz cut. Some trimmers do cut so close that it may appear to be a head shave, unless looking closely. So most people will still think of it as a head shave.Another consideration, if you hair is dark, and you have pale skin, the "shadow" left by a trimmer will be very pronounced. A true razor blade head shave will result in less of a shadow. Some electric shavers come close to a razor blade.
